why NH4NO2 is unstable??and how HNO2 and NO will react with K2Cr2O7
It is well known that nitrates are produced in the soil in the final stage of nitrification and in this process there is the intermediate formation of the NH4NO2 and hence NH4NO2 is unstable and breaks up readily into nitrogen gas and water
